The Commonwealth of Massachusetts William Francis Galvin, Secretary of the Commonwealth Public Records Division Rebecca S. Murray Supervisor of Records October 5, 2021 SPR21/2419 Helene Bettencourt Associate Commissioner Commissioner’s Office Department of Elementary and Secondary Education 75 Pleasant Street Malden, MA 02148 Dear Ms. Bettencourt: I have received the petition of Joseph Smith appealing the response of the Department of Elementary and Secondary Education (Department) to his request for public records. G. L. c. 66, § 10A; see also 950 C.M.R. 32.08(1). On July 30, 2021, Mr. Smith requested, “… records which show the DESE RAO reporting or discussing the ‘technical challenges’…” Prior appeal The requested records were the subject of a prior appeal. See SPR21/2146 Determination of the Supervisor of Records (September 8, 2021). In my September 8th determination, I ordered the Department to provide a response. On September 13, 2021, the Department responded. Unsatisfied with the Department’s response, Mr. Smith petitioned this office and this appeal, SPR21/2419, was opened as a result. Based upon a conversation between a Public Records Division staff attorney and a Department representative, it is my understanding that the Department intends on providing a subsequent response to Mr. Smith. Accordingly, the Department is ordered to provide Mr. Smith with a response to his request, in a manner consistent with the Public Records Law and its Regulations within 10 business days. It is preferable to send an electronic copy of this response to this office at pre@sec.state.ma.us. Mr. Smith may appeal the substantive nature of the Department’s response within ninety days.
